Maroni's To Reopen After Owner-Chef's Death

The restaurant famous for its meatballs will reopen after the death of its owner-chef Michael Maroni.

(Maroni's)

Maroni Cuisine is set to reopen on Wednesday following the death of its owner-chef Michael Maroni.

Maroni, 57, who died after suffering from a medical issue while swimming in his indoor pool on Thursday, will have visiting hours held for him at Nolan Funeral Home in Northport.

According to a sign posted on the restaurant's door, visitation Tuesday is from 2 to 5 p.m. and 7 to 9 p.m.

"The Maroni family truly appreciates your heartfelt thoughts and prayers at this difficult time," the sign reads.

Opening in 2001, Maroni Cuisine is known for its tasting menu and pots of meatballs.
